GPT-5.6 Sol's PowerPoint, Excel and document outputs were judged the most visually attractive of any model; Claude Fable 5 leads on rubric substance and analytical quality.

Individual evaluations

The evals that are directly comparable across labs, from each provider's official launch table. Evals whose variants differ between labs (OSWorld 2.0 vs OSWorld-Verified, HLE with vs without tools) are deliberately excluded rather than mixed.

Where this data comes from

Independent measurement

The Intelligence Index, Coding Agent Index, cost per task and AA-Briefcase figures are from Artificial Analysis, which runs its evaluations independently against live provider APIs: these are not vendor claims.

Self-reported launch figures

The individual evaluations (SWE-bench Pro, Terminal-Bench 2.1, GDPval-AA v2) come from each lab's official launch tables and system cards. They are self-reported: harnesses and prompt scaffolds vary by lab, so treat cross-lab deltas of a point or two as noise.

Provider price lists

Per-token pricing is each provider's published API rate card, cross-checked against OpenRouter listings. Promotional rates are noted where they apply. Unpublished values are shown as “n/a”, never estimated.

Observed serving data (OpenRouter)

The “Serving” column is snapshotted from OpenRouter's public API: live provider endpoints per model, median 1-day uptime, and the maximum context length actually served, which sometimes differs from the claimed figure (GPT-5.6 serves at 1.05M tokens on OpenRouter against the reported 1.5M). Throughput and latency are not exposed on the public API, so we do not chart them.

Our own derivation: the AITR Value For Money Index

The AITR Value For Money Index is ours, Intelligence Index points per US dollar of cost per task (Intelligence ÷ cost). It is pure declared arithmetic on the sourced inputs above, with no editorial weighting, and it surfaces what the headline charts hide: the value frontier belongs to the cheap open-weights models.
